Transaction 0b610599252ece5273370bba9d167a14569db8687cf50ef9a83a53ab9891f03e
1 Input
1 Outputs
- 0b610599252ece5273370bba9d167a14569db8687cf50ef9a83a53ab9891f03e:0
value 3288210
address 1HEQzCboTENvEYhaTsQutTK2Q8mJkTPv4T